Reports of the 1979 Advisory Council on Social Security.

The 1979 Advisory Council on Social Security, appointed in February 1978, was charged with reviewing all aspects of the social security program, particularly financing, the general benefit structure, universal coverage, disability insurance, and the treatment of women and families. Report of the Advisory Council on Social Security: The Status of the Social Security Program and Recommendations for Its Improvement

As required by law, this Advisory Council was appointed by the Secretary of Health, Education, and Welfare in 1963. It, is the second Advisory Council appointed under the Social Security Amendments of 1956. The first was appointed in 1957 and made its report on January 1, 1959. Social Security Reform and Financial Markets

Social Security is in trouble. With declining population growth and rising life expectancy, the cost of Social Security benefits is rising relative to payroll tax revenues. As a result, the Social Security retirement fund is expected to run out around 2030.1 Recently, the 1994–1996 Advisory Council on Social Security (1997) proposed three different plans to address the problem. Men and women: changing roles and social security.

In the Social Security Amendments of 1977, Congress called for a study to examine ways to eliminate dependency as a factor in determining entitlement to spouse's benefits under the social security program as well as proposals to bring about the equal treatment of men and women.
